Broadstep is Hiring a Quality Assurance Specialist Near Milwaukee, WI

Broadstep has been a leader in providing a continuum of physical, emotional, and mental support for children and ad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ities (I/DD), mental illness, and co-occurring disorders for over 45 years. As one of America’s leading I/DD and behavioral health providers, our vision is to be America’s first-choice in behavioral health and supportive living. This is an extraordinary opportunity for a person with a high level of attention to detail and desire to assist the workforce in being the best they can be. This great opportunity is located in Milwaukee, Wisconsin SUMMARY: The Quality Assurance Specialist coordinates and implements all activities within the Business Performance Management System policy and procedure within the subsidiary. The core areas of focus within the Business Performance Management System include but are not limited to: (1) Infrastructure and Information Management; (2) Education & Leadership; (3) Performance Auditing; and, (4) Perfection, Evolution and Innovation Management. Also, the Quality Assurance Specialist ensures implementation of the dynamic systems of Information Management; Software Integration Management; Employee Education & Support; Technology Improvement Planning; Electronic file structure/data storage management; and, IT Disaster Plan Management in order to ensure the ongoing utilization and maximization of IT functionality, and to preserve and protect proprietary and confidential information. Additionally, the Quality Assurance Specialist is responsible for implementing, monitoring and improving all program operations relating to safety and security of individuals served and the facilities in which the company conducts business. D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: The Quality Assurance Specialist will: · Provide and ensure the complete service delivery in a healthy and safe manner that supports Broadstep’s vision, mission and values Ensure the integration and implementation of all Broadstep and subsidiary policies,procedures, state-specific regulatory requirements, contract stipulations andaccreditation standards, including but not limited to:· Knowledge that abuse (physical, sexual, verbal/psychological), neglect, exploitation and misappropriation and other code of ethics violations are against the law and company code of conduct. The team member must be able to implement all facets of the company’s Abuse, Neglect, Exploitation and Misappropriation policy, including the responsibility of being a mandatory reporter. Per state requirements and company policy, team members will report immediately to the state licenser, appropriate company personnel and external contacts, and they will fully participate in all stages of an investigation pertaining to suspected abuse by team members, parents and others. Additionally, the team member must comply with any external (County, State or Federal) investigation or inspection. · Knowledge of all individual rights and the ability to identify, intervene and report appropriately when observing a violation; · Knowledge of the confidentiality policy and HIPAA laws, and always apply the practices governing those policies and legislation; · Knowledge of the subsidiary-implemented crisis intervention programs and be able to implement all protocols as identified in the individual’s treatment plan; · Knowledge of all company transportation procedures and operates all personal and company vehicles in accordance with those policies; · Knowledge of all company crisis/emergency plans and applies that knowledge during each test drill and actual crisis situation; · Ensure the integration and implementation of all BBH and subsidiary quality assurance policies, procedures, State-specific regulatory requirements, contract stipulations and accreditation standards; Oversee the process of daily, monthly, semi-annual and annual review of subsidiary performance based upon strategic plans and organizational goals;EnsEnure the implementation of the processes defined in the Infrastructure and Information Management phase of the Business Performance Management System Policy and Procedure; · Conduct field consultations every six (6) months with the respective program supervisor with the goal of training the standards to each level throughout the system; · Measure and analyze the processes and outcomes of the Business Performance Management System and recommend a course of action for improvement as necessary; · · Performs other related duties as assigned by management. QUALIFICATIONS:· Possess a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ration or Human Service related fields (preferred); · Possess a minimum of one (1) year of quality assurance experience· Preferred: o Possess a Green Belt, Black Belt, or Lean Six Sigma certification; o One or more years of supervisory experience; o One or more years of experience with individuals meeting the program admission criteria· Meet all licensing requirements set forth by the respective state of operation;
